One thing that helped me was learning the basics of search engine optimization (SEO). It’s not just about ranking higher on Google — it’s really about making sure your business shows up when local customers are looking for your services. For example, optimizing your Google Business Profile, creating simple content around customer questions, and building a few strong backlinks can make a huge difference.
